Who gave to this committee

These major donors — gifts of $50,000 or more — gave to TEXANS FOR A CONSERVATIVE MAJORITY. TEXANS FOR A CONSERVATIVE MAJORITY then decided what to spend it on, by itself. Giving to a committee is not the same as giving to a candidate.

We hold $2.5M in gifts of $50,000 or more — of the $2.7M this committee told the FEC it took in for 2024, about 94%.

We only show major donors — gifts of $50,000 or more. The rest includes smaller donors and money the law does not require anyone to itemize by name. A short list here does not mean a committee has few backers.
